Next.js + React: SSR/SSG, App Router, interfaces, and production pages.
Sanity/Strapi: editorial content, blog, landing pages, cases, and localization.
Stripe/Supabase/Firebase: payments, auth, forms, data, and integrations when the project needs them.
TypeScript: typed data contracts and fewer regressions as the product grows.
Cypress/Storybook: checks for critical flows and stable UI components.
Vercel/Netlify: deployment, preview environments, monitoring, and faster iteration.

How I work
Planning
Scope, priorities, page map, user flows, CMS needs, integrations, and acceptance criteria. The output is a practical delivery plan, not a vague discovery document.
Structure and UI
Reusable sections, responsive layouts, accessibility basics, content states, and page patterns that can support new service pages, landing pages, or app flows later.
Development
Next.js + TypeScript, Sanity/Strapi CMS, protected admin routes, environment-based secrets, preview deployments on Vercel, handover notes for the team. Stack chosen per project.
Optimization and release
Metadata, sitemap, canonical, schema, redirects, image handling, caching, analytics events, form checks, and post-launch fixes for priority pages and flows.
